Maybe it's something in Flosstradamus' Chicago roots that inclined them to turn "Rollin" into juke music, but that is certainly what they've done. The original track is a laid-back, lyrics-centric piece, but Flosstradamus injects the adrenaline into it, replacing the original's handclaps with much busier snares, and some swirly synths on top. Paper Route Gangstaz Fear and Loathing in Hunts Vegas dropped yesterday, and while this remix isn't on it, you will find more worthy lyrics like "Rollin' on the river got the dro' and the liquor/at the store get the Swisher, Tropicana and a Twister." So for all of you 7-Eleven attendants who've wondered why 4 guys with dreadlocks wander into your store at 2 in the morning to buy a single Swisher Sweets, this mixtape could be a learning experience for you.
